ABOUT THE ROLE
We are looking for a Senior Data Engineer to take ownership of our data infrastructure, designing and optimizing high-performance, scalable solutions. You’ll work with AWS and big data frameworks like Hadoop and Spark to drive impactful data initiatives across the company.
WHAT YOU WILL DO
* Design, build, and maintain large-scale data pipelines and data processing systems in AWS.
* Develop and optimize distributed data workflows using Hadoop, Spark, and related technologies.
* Collaborate with data scientists, analysts, and product teams to deliver reliable and efficient data solutions.
* Implement best practices for data governance, security, and compliance.
* Monitor, troubleshoot, and improve the performance of data systems and pipelines.
* Mentor junior engineers and contribute to building a culture of technical excellence.
* Evaluate and recommend new tools, frameworks, and approaches for data engineering.
MUST HAVES
*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field;
* 5+ years of experience in data engineering, software engineering, or related roles;
* Strong hands-on expertise with AWS services (S3, EMR, Glue, Lambda, Redshift, etc.);
* Deep knowledge of big data ecosystems, including Hadoop (HDFS, Hive, MapReduce) and Apache Spark (PySpark, Spark SQL, streaming);
* Strong SQL skills and experience with relational and NoSQL databases;
* Proficiency in Python, Java, or Scala for data processing and automation;
* Experience with workflow orchestration tools (Airflow, Step Functions, etc.);
* Solid understanding of data modeling, ETL/ELT processes, and data warehousing concepts;
*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to work in fast-paced environments;
* Ability to work German TimeZone (:6 - 7 am to : 2-3 pm Brazil/ ART time),
* Upper-Intermediate English level.
NICE TO HAVES
* Experience with real-time data streaming platforms (Kafka, Kinesis, Flink).
* Knowledge of containerization and or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es).
* Familiarity with data governance, lineage, and catalog tools.
* Previous leadership or mentoring experience.
